.NET Micro Framework for Linux
Development
The .NET Micro Framework for Linux is a small, free and open-source platform by Microsoft that allows writing .NET applications for resource-constrained devices running Linux. It includes a small version of the .NET runtime and libraries.

Foxit PhantomPDF
Office & Productivity
Foxit PhantomPDF is a PDF reader, editor, creator, converter and collaborator. It provides an affordable and easy-to-use alternative to Adobe Acrobat with the ability to view, create, edit, convert, organize, secure, share, sign and collaborate on PDF documents.
